Fishtail Braids

A long fishtail braid offers an organic look for women who want a unique hairstyle on their wedding day. The design will appear romantic with loose strands that fall out of the braid for a classic hairstyle that has a modern twist with the fishtail design. It makes for a messy style that is somewhat whimsical and perfect for a rustic or vintage event.

Twisted Updos

Twisted updos are all the rage at bridal shows for a classic and modern look that is plenty elegant for brides. The style is ideal for medium hair lengths and can even feature a decorative clip that securely fastens the twist in the back. A delicate crown or floral headpiece can also be used to enhance the hairstyle and add some extra detail.

Low Buns

Low buns were commonly seen at weddings in the early ’90s and have officially made a comeback on the wedding scene. The look is elegant and allows more attention to be given to the facial features of the bride. To create a modern bun that looks contemporary, opt for making a part down the middle of the hair and have each strand slicked back for an upscale and formal appearance. A beaded or diamond headband can also be used to keep the hair in place and add a touch of formality to the look.

Curled Updos

For a romantic and whimsical hairstyle that is appropriate for various styles of weddings, curled updos are ideal for brides who have longer hair. The style groups all of the strands together and allows the curls to be bunched together in the back of the hair. A braid or two can even be used in the front of the hair for added detail that creates a gorgeous and feminine hairstyle at each angle. Add a few flowers or a headpiece to enhance the overall design and create a memorable look that is truly classic.

Side-swept Hair

Create a dramatic hairstyle by sweeping the mane to the side to enhance the amount of volume that is created with the locks. According to One 10 Makeup, “The style is timeless and most appropriate when paired with a strapless gowns for a hairstyle that is gorgeous with some dramatic chandelier earrings. Wavy curls that look natural are most ideal for hair that cascades down and offers a red carpet appearance. You can also insert a large flower on the side of the hair where it’s pinned back to dress up the look.”

Side-swept hair updos are also just as elegant and are ideal for brides who want their hair to be kept out of their face during the ceremony and reception.

High Ponytails

For the modern bride who wants to look chic, high ponytails offer a vogue look that is anything but old fashioned when walking down the aisle. Opt for blowing out the hair to enhance the volume while twisting a few strands around the hair band. It makes for an unconventional hairstyle that works best on brides who have strong facial features, bold earrings, and dramatic makeup.
